The Ledesma Bridge over the Tormes River, in the province of Salamanca, is a historic structure that forms part of the rich heritage of this medieval town. Old Ledesma Bridge Location: It crosses the Tormes River at the entrance to the town of Ledesma. Construction: Although it is believed to have existed in Roman times, the current bridge was built in the 15th century, during the reign of Beltrán de la Cueva. New Bridge Construction: Inaugurated on July 24, 1954, after decades of planning interrupted by the Spanish Civil War. Material: Cyclopean concrete.

Also called Puente Nuevo, inaugurated in 1954, built in full urban expansion. From this point we can see the Tormes River and the Old Bridge, which was built in the fifteenth century.

Castle from the 15th century, declared an Asset of Cultural Interest in 1949. It was recently renovated and belongs to the Ledesma City Council.

15th century masonry arch bridge over the Tormes river. Many believe that it replaced an even older bridge dating from Roman times. Spectacular views of the new and old bridges that span the river landscape.

Ledesma still preserves a large part of the granite stone wall that has historically surrounded the Villa in its entirety. Most of what remains today was built in the time of Fernando II de León, in the 12th century, although it was in the 15th century when several canvases with well-carved masonry were renovated.

What kind of historical sites can I explore in Ledesma?

Ledesma is rich in history, offering several notable sites. You can visit the Tormes River – Ledesma Bridge, a historic structure with parts dating back to the 15th century. Another significant site is La Fortaleza - Ledesma Castle, which preserves a large section of the 12th-century granite stone wall that once surrounded the town.

Are there any Roman-era structures around Ledesma?

Yes, the area features the Puente Mocho, a bridge considered to be of Roman origin and cataloged as an Asset of Cultural Interest. It is part of an ancient Roman road, offering a glimpse into the region's distant past.
